What is kiwi composed of? Water makes up about 80% of a kiwi's weight. It's well known that fruits with a high water content are very beneficial to overall health. Kiwi also contains about 10% sugars, along with a small amount of protein. Potassium is the most concentrated mineral in kiwi, along with iron, calcium, phosphorus, magnesium, and a significant amount of vitamin C, vitamin A, and numerous antioxidants.

Benefits of Kiwi for People with High Blood Pressure:
1. A recent study presented at the American Heart Association's Scientific Sessions in Orlando found that regularly eating kiwifruit three times a day reduces high blood pressure. The study conducted numerous trials on patients with high blood pressure and found a significant improvement in their health with kiwifruit consumption.
2. A single kiwifruit contains a large amount of the antioxidant lutein. This substance helps protect people with high blood pressure from developing atherosclerosis or other serious heart conditions. Lutein also helps improve blood pressure levels.
3. Eating kiwifruit alleviates the circulatory problems that many people with high blood pressure experience.
4. Kiwifruit helps people with high blood pressure get rid of excess bad cholesterol in their blood. Kiwifruit contains no fat, but the antioxidants it contains help fight harmful fats and lipids that accumulate in the body, especially in the arteries of the heart.
5. Kiwifruit is the fruit with the highest potassium content after bananas. Potassium is known to be one of the most important minerals for controlling and lowering high blood pressure by increasing urination.
6. Doctors consider kiwifruit a natural heart tonic. It also protects blood vessels from damage and serious complications that can be caused by high blood pressure.
7. The antioxidants in kiwifruit strengthen the immune system, thus protecting against severe colds and other illnesses that could worsen health conditions.
